[09-07-2025] Woman Killed in Head-On Crash with Suspected DUI Driver on SR-41An 87-year-old woman from Fresno was killed in a head-on crash involving a suspected DUI driver on SR-41 in Madera on Sunday evening, September 7, 2025.

According to the California Highway Patrol, the crash occurred around 7:37 p.m. when a 30-year-old Oakhurst woman, driving a Honda Accord northbound on SR-41, veered into the southbound lane and collided with a white Ford Escape.

The crash caused major damage to both vehicles, blocking the roadway. Despite efforts from good Samaritans and medical personnel, the right-front passenger in the Ford was pronounced dead at the scene.

Both drivers were transported to Community Regional Medical Center in Fresno with major injuries. The driver of the Honda was arrested on suspicion of felony DUI and additional charges.

Witnesses reported that the Honda driver had been driving recklessly, passing several vehicles over double yellow lines before the crash. The suspect remains in custody at the hospital and will be booked into Madera County Jail after being medically cleared.

The investigation is ongoing.
